Title:
HEATER AND THERMAL HEAD
Document Type and Number:
Japanese Patent JPH1174102
Kind Code:
A
Abstract:
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a heater having a superior thermal response characteristic and a high durability by integrally arranging an exothermic resistor on a high thermal-conductivity silicon nitride substrate, in which a crystalline compound phase is contained in a grain boundary phase at a specific volumetric ratio and which has porosity, a three-point bending strength, and thermal conductivity which respectively fall within specific ranges. SOLUTION: A high thermal-conductivity silicon nitride substrate 11 which is composed of silicon nitride particles and a grain boundary phase, in which a crystal compound phase is contained at a volumetric ratio of about 20% or higher with respect to the overall volume of the grain boundary phase and has a porosity of about 1.5 vol.% or lower, a three-point bending strength of about 80 kg/mm<2> or higher, and thermal conductivity of about 60 W/m.K or higher, is used for a heater. The heater is obtained by forming an exothermic resistor 12 composed of tantalum nitride on the surface of the substrate 11, and an insulating layer 13 is formed integrally on the surface of the substrate 11 so as to cover a resistor 12. Therefore, the heater can exhibit superior thermal response characteristic with respect to the turning on/off of a voltage applied across the resistor 12 and, in addition, has high durability.
